Rust中的workspace的详细介绍

java项目中用maven管理代码时,如果遇到大型工程,一般会拆分成不同的模块,比如spring-mvc中,通常会按model, view, controller建3个模块,然后根据一定的依赖关系进行引用。这个概念在Rust中是通用的,只不过maven换成了cargo,而模块变成了crate,看下面的例子。

一、目录结构

.
├── Cargo.toml
├── controller
│   ├── Cargo.toml
│   └── src
│       └── main.rs
├── model
│   ├── Cargo.toml
│   └── src
│       └── lib.rs
└── view
    ├── Cargo.toml
    └── src
        └── lib.rs

根目录下的Cargo.toml,类似maven中的父pom.xml,可以在其中声明子"模块":(注:为了避免与rust中的mod"模块"产生混淆,后面还是用crate来称呼“子模块”)

[workspace]

members=[

    "model",

    "view",

    "controller"

]

这里声明了1个所谓的workspace,其中有3个成员,即3个目录对应的crate  

二、子crata中的Cargo.toml声明

假设上面的工程结构中:

则这3个crate中的Cargo.toml文件,可以这样写:

model/Cargo.toml

[package]

name = "model"

version = "0.1.0"

edition = "2021"

# See more keys and their definitions at https://doc.rust-lang.org/cargo/reference/manifest.html

[dependencies]

# 不依赖其它crate,此节点为空即可

view/Cargo.toml

[package]

name = "view"

version = "0.1.0"

edition = "2021"

# See more keys and their definitions at https://doc.rust-lang.org/cargo/reference/manifest.html

[dependencies]

# 声明依赖model

model = {path = "../model"}

controll/Cargo.toml

[package]

name = "controller"

version = "0.1.0"

edition = "2021"

# See more keys and their definitions at https://doc.rust-lang.org/cargo/reference/manifest.html

[dependencies]

model = {path = "../model"}

view = {path = "../view"}

三、代码引用

有了前面的各crate依赖声明,就可以来写代码了,参见下面的示例:

3.1 model/src/lib.rs

3.2 view/src/lib.rs

//使用model中的User类

use model::User;

pub fn get_login_info(name:String,pass:String)->User{

    User{

        username:name,

        password:pass

    }

}

3.3 controller/src/main.rs

use view::get_login_info;

use model::{User,Order};

fn main() {

    let mut u = get_login_info(String::from("test"), String::from("123456"));

    u.password = String::from("abcde");

    println!("{:?}", u);

  

    let o = Order{

        orderno:String::from("20211244123")

    };

    println!("{:?}",o);

  

    let u1 = User{

        username:String::from("abcd"),

        password:String::from("*123*J")

    };

    println!("{:?}",u1);

}

运行结果:

User { username: "test", password: "abcde" }
Order { orderno: "20211244123" }
User { username: "abcd", password: "*123*J" }
